Anthony Smith (American politician)

Anthony Smith was the Republican President of the West Virginia Senate from Tyler County and served from 1901 to 1903.

On August 14, 1862, when he was 18 years old, he enrolled in Company F, Fourteenth Regiment, West Virginia Volunteer Infantry.

He served numerous political offices over the years, including state delegate, state senator, and prosecuting attorney of Tyler County.

On December 20, 1870, he married Martha F. Holland, they had two children, a son and daughter.
